Capacity note for the Fennelgrid sidecar review. Aggregation window widened to cut emit rate; per-pod memory ceiling holds at current cardinality (~12k series). CPU flat. Risk: buffer overflow if a tenant spikes labels — mitigated by the drop policy. No node-pool changes needed for the Caldermoor cluster this quarter. Review the flush and buffer settings before merge. Constants under review are below.

limits module of yafop-hahag:
QUOTAS = {
    "tamwyn": 652,
    "prawyn": 731,
}

Welcome to the Feedwright team. Our podcast feed validator, Spoolcheck, runs nightly against every partner catalog and flags malformed episodes before publication. Your first task is restoring your local signing store so Spoolcheck can verify fixtures. The restore wizard will prompt once; when it does, enter the recovery passphrase shown below.

strongbox words: praath-queniel-holax-druael-jorath-noveth-druok

## Tuning

Idempotency keys guard Fennelpay retries. Each payment attempt mints a key scoped to order plus attempt window; replays inside the window return the cached result rather than charging twice. Key TTL must exceed the longest plausible retry storm, including queue backlog during incidents, but not so long that storage bloats. Window sizing and cache bounds were set after the March duplicate-charge scare and should not be lowered casually. Current constants, enforced at startup, are:

tuning table, kajog-bawip:
TIERS = {
    "kelius": 256,
    "lammir": 543,
}